Celebrating College Excellence 2024

Across Washington State University (WSU) spring is a time to recognize those who go above and beyond, making an impact in their programs, the university, and their communities. Along with the College of Pharmacy and Pharmaceutical Sciences (CPPS) awards, students, faculty and staff are also recognized by the WSU Spokane campus. It is with great pride the college announces the following CPPS faculty, staff, and student student awards as well as WSU Spokane Chancellor’s Excellence Awards received by CPPS students, faculty, and staff.

CPPS Student Awards

CPPS student awards are selected by faculty and staff, recognizing students who have shown a commitment to academic performance, leadership, scholarship, service and professionalism. This year’s recipients received their awards during our recent Celebrating Excellence and Generosity events in Yakima and Spokane. Graduating Doctor of Pharmacy students will receive their awards separately during commencement week celebrations in May.
